Output 70785d34ac887a70418159b4ad58cc6236a6714cc4fbe78aaa38f3f5e90d9efc:0

value
31253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75fa85b805b420200ed039b2b788b44a545dca2b OP_EQUAL
address
3CSq6ats39L55YicUt1ijJYJBqPqbiBX9o
transaction
70785d34ac887a70418159b4ad58cc6236a6714cc4fbe78aaa38f3f5e90d9efc
spent
true